United Nations Youth Task Force Holds First Coordination Meeting in Tripoli

Tripoli: The United Nations is organizing its first coordination meeting to support youth participation and address their priorities. The United Nations Youth Task Force in Libya held its first joint coordination meeting today in Tripoli with the House of Representatives' Sustainable Development Goals Committee and the Ministry of Youth, with the participation of UN agencies, members of parliament, and other national institutions.

According to Libyan News Agency, the meeting focused on strengthening cooperation to support youth participation and address their priorities. Participants discussed practical steps to improve youth-friendly legislation, use data to inform decision-making, expand opportunities for skills development and innovation, promote climate-related environmental initiatives, and build partnerships with the private sector.

Participants agreed on the importance of translating youth priorities into concrete policies, investments, and programs that achieve tangible results on the ground, in line with the Sustainable Development Goals.
